Freigeben über


DatagramSocketControl.QualityOfService Eigenschaft

Definition

Ruft die Dienstqualität für ein DatagramSocket-Objekt ab oder legt diese fest.

public:
 property SocketQualityOfService QualityOfService { SocketQualityOfService get(); void set(SocketQualityOfService value); };
SocketQualityOfService QualityOfService();

void QualityOfService(SocketQualityOfService value);
public SocketQualityOfService QualityOfService { get; set; }
var socketQualityOfService = datagramSocketControl.qualityOfService;
datagramSocketControl.qualityOfService = socketQualityOfService;
Public Property QualityOfService As SocketQualityOfService

Eigenschaftswert

Die Dienstqualität für ein DatagramSocket-Objekt . Der Standardwert ist normal.

Windows-Anforderungen

App-Funktionen
ID_CAP_NETWORKING [Windows Phone]

Hinweise

Diese QualityOfService-Eigenschaft ist die Dienstqualität, die das DatagramSocket-Objekt bereitstellen sollte. Der Standardwert ist Normal.

Wenn die Eigenschaft auf einen anderen Wert als normal festgelegt ist, folgt der Socket einer Richtlinie, um die angegebene Dienstqualität bereitzustellen. Wenn die Eigenschaft auf lowLatency festgelegt ist, wird die Threadpriorität der eingehenden Pakete auf einen höheren Wert festgelegt. Der Wert "lowLatency " wird häufig für Audio- oder ähnliche Apps verwendet, die zeitlich empfindlich sind. Diese Eigenschaft wird normalerweise nicht für andere Apps festgelegt.

Diese Eigenschaft kann festgelegt werden, bevor das DatagramSocket gebunden oder verbunden ist. Nachdem das DatagramSocket gebunden oder verbunden ist, führt das Festlegen dieser Eigenschaft zu einem Fehler.

Gilt für:

Weitere Informationen